2. Upgrade Your Network Hardware
Upgrading your network hardware is another way to boost your network performance. Old routers and cables can slow down your connection speed and cause latency issues.
You should regularly update your routers, switches, and cables to ensure optimal performance. Make sure you buy hardware that supports the latest Wi-Fi standards, such as Wi-Fi 6 (802.11ax).
Investing in high-quality Ethernet cables can also improve your network speed and stability. Cat 6 or Cat 7 cables are recommended for high-speed connections.
3. Optimize Your Wi-Fi Signal
If you use Wi-Fi, ensure that your home or office has a strong signal. You can use a Wi-Fi analyzer tool to check your signal strength and identify any sources of interference.
To enhance your Wi-Fi signal, consider the following:
- Place your router in a central location where it can reach all corners of your house/office.
- Upgrade your Wi-Fi antennas for longer range and stronger signals.
- Use a Wi-Fi repeater or extenders to amplify your signal in dead zones.
4. Secure Your Network
Securing your network is important for avoiding security breaches and optimizing your connection.
Here are a few tips to secure your network:
- Change the default login credentials on your router.
- Create a strong Wi-Fi password with a mix of letters, numbers, and symbols, and change it regularly.
- Enable WPA2 encryption to protect your Wi-Fi network from unauthorized access.
- Use a VPN to encrypt your internet traffic and add an extra layer of security.

6. Manage Your Bandwidth
Bandwidth management is crucial for optimizing your network performance, especially if you have multiple devices connected to your network.
You can manage your bandwidth by:
- Limiting bandwidth for certain applications or devices that consume too much traffic.
- Enable Quality of Service (QoS) features in your router to give priority to important applications, such as video conferencing or online gaming.
- Consider using a bandwidth-monitoring tool to track your internet usage and identify the sources of high traffic.
